Pull to refresh

Comments 22

UFO just landed and posted this here
Спасибо за уточнение, пример хороший, если не ошибаюсь в ВК это не так уж и давно ввели.
Я его использовал, когда заказчик говорил примерно так: «Что ты мне текстовый редактор даёшь со своим списком? Мне нужны отдельные поля!».
Да да да… не так давно сам узнал про эту тему. Во времена 6ки всё писалось ручками :)
Набор модулей это вещь интимная, у каждого он свой, особенно если разговор идет о высоконагруженных проектах. Как универсальный набор не годится, как краткий обзор лучших в своей категории модулей еще может быть.
Забыли про Drush, который сократит на установку всех остальных модулей.
Да, точно. Drush для администрирования — очень нужный компонент.
drush — это не модуль. drush — это софтина. Ставится один раз на девелоперскую тачку и на всю жизнь :)
UFO just landed and posted this here
UFO just landed and posted this here
От себя хочется добавить еще несколько модулей.

Администрирование:
  • Admin — красивая выезжающая паленька для модераторов.
  • Drush — Drupal shell, пакет для работы с друпалом и модулями через консоль.


Представления и внешний вид
  • Panels — предоставляет возможность разбивать содержимое страницы на регионы (более продвинутое использование стандартных регионов Drupal). Очень проникся этим модулем, и использую его во всех своих последних проектах.


Разработка:
  • Features — позволяет сливать определенные данные из базы в код в виде модулей для последующего переноса (например с сервера разработки на препродакшен сервер).
  • Views Import — модуль с функционалом заточеным только на импорт views. После разработки все вьюхи экспортируются в отдельные файлики и кладутся в import/ папочку. После активации модуля на продакшн сервере — все эти вьюхи автоматически создаются. Очень удобно, т.к. можно проследить через git, что и как изменялось.
  • Panels Import — aналогичный модуль, только для Panels.


Перевод
  • Localization client — малоизвестный модуль, поможет визуально находить и переводить текст на сайте. Очень помог мне в свое время.
Т.с. вы бы топик переименовали… А то складывается впечатления, просмотреть ваш выбор пары десятков из >10к модулей что джентльмены кроме водки и макарон по флотски ничего больше готовить не умеют :)
UFO just landed and posted this here
Модули Administration menu и Inline Messages имеют одинаковые ссылки. Поправьте.
Может кто знает модуль для авторизации пользователей из IPB?
  • Модуль Inline Messages — вывод сообщений в том блоке, где возникла проблема


Я бы заменил на «Вывод сообщений формы в тот блок, где находится форма».
UFO just landed and posted this here
Она полезна, когда одна и та же страница имеет разный вид в зависимости от пользователя, роли, материалов, терминов и прочее — причём этих страниц должно быть несколько, иначе просто обойтись и page-XXX.tpl.php.
И она ближе к девелоперу, пользователям лучше Panels…
UFO just landed and posted this here
Я бы добавила для SEO
Global Redirect — этот модуль автоматически производит все нужные нам 301 перенаправления для всех страниц сайта.
Pathauto – модуль автоматически формирует адреса создаваемых страниц на основе информации о статье (обычно на основе её заголовка — title).
Transliteration – если ваш сайт на кириллице, то вам нужен и этот модуль. Он преобразует кириллические заголовки страниц в транслит, перед постановкой их в url.
XML-Sitemap Думаю, пояснения не нужны.
Page Title — модуль позволяет более гибко настроить заголовки страниц (содержание тега ).
Metatags Quick – позволяет к типу материала добавить текстовое поле «meta». Содержание этого поля будет располагаться в заголовке html кода, в теге meta.

Среди модулей похожих статей наиболее удобным и простым показался вот этот. Similar Entries

Ну и, разумеется Backup and migrate Позволяет удобно сохранять БД и портировать сайт. Удобен и прост. При создании сайтов можно сделать «шаблон», чтобы не создавать сайт с нуля каждый раз, а только его донастраивать.

Строго не судите, если это не совсем базовые модули)) Мне они сильно облегчили жизнь.
Sign up to leave a comment.

Articles